U.S. National Missile Defense (NMD) Consensus
- A growing consensus in the U.S. supports the development of a limited NMD system to protect against attacks from rogue states, such as North Korea, Iraq, and Iran.
- The system is intended to intercept a limited number of long-range missiles, possibly armed with nuclear, chemical, or biological weapons.
- The U.S. government has expressed a desire to continue negotiating reductions in Russian nuclear forces alongside the NMD program.
NMD Funding and Budgets
- From FY 1998 to FY 2001, U.S. funding for NMD increased significantly, reaching $2,034 million in FY 2001.
- The BMDO budget for FY 2001 was $4.8 billion, with $1.85 billion allocated to NMD-related programs.
- The Clinton administration planned a $10.5 billion investment for NMD from FY 2001 to 2005, while the Bush administration aimed for a substantial increase in the FY 2002 budget.
NMD System Architecture
- The proposed system includes a land-based architecture with multiple elements such as interceptors, radars, and satellites.
- The system is designed to intercept missiles during the mid-course phase of flight, using exo-atmospheric kill vehicles (EKVs) and ground-based interceptors (GBIs).
- The system would include 100 GBIs initially, with plans to expand to 250 GBIs across two sites (Alaska and North Dakota) by the end of the Clinton administration.
- The system relies on X-band tracking radars, upgraded early warning radars, and space-based infrared sensors (SBIRS).
System Costs
- The CBO estimated the cost of the Expanded Capability 1 phase to be $29.5 billion through FY 2015, including $20.9 billion in procurement and $8.5 billion in operations.
- The full ground-based system is estimated to cost $48.5 billion, while the SBIRS-Low satellite system alone would add $10.6 billion.
- Total estimated cost of the system is $59.1 billion, excluding the cost of the SBIRS-Low system.
Programme Problems
- The NMD program has faced significant technical and operational challenges, particularly with the development of the ground-based interceptor missile.
- The Integrated Flight Test Programme has had mixed results, with only one successful test out of five, raising doubts about the system's reliability and effectiveness.
- The U.S. government postponed the authorization of NMD deployment in 2000 due to insufficient data on the system's performance and technical capabilities.
Alternative NMD Systems
- There is growing interest in alternative architectures, such as boost-phase intercept systems and multi-layer defense systems.
- The Bush administration advocated for a more robust, multi-layered NMD system that would include air-, sea-, and space-based components.
- These systems are not permitted under the ABM Treaty, which prohibits the development of such systems unless the treaty is amended or replaced.
Theatre Missile Defense (TMD) Programs
- TMD systems are designed to protect U.S. overseas facilities and troops from short- to intermediate-range ballistic missiles and cruise missiles.
- The U.S. has several TMD development programs, including the Navy Area Defense (NAD) and the Patriot Advanced Capability-3 (PAC-3).
- The U.S. has also collaborated with Israel on the Arrow Weapon System (AWS), which is now operational.
International Concerns and ABM Treaty
- The ABM Treaty is seen as a cornerstone of strategic stability, and its potential amendment or replacement has raised concerns among Russia, China, and other states.
- Russia has strongly opposed any changes to the ABM Treaty, viewing it as a threat to the principle of mutual assured destruction (MAD).
- The U.S. has attempted to gain Russian cooperation by offering joint exercises and financial support for Russia's early-warning radar system.
U.S. and Russian Positions
- The U.S. has shifted from seeking amendments to the ABM Treaty to advocating for its complete replacement, as stated by President George W. Bush.
- The Bush administration has indicated a willingness to offer incentives, such as purchasing Russian S-300 missiles, to gain Russian support for a new missile defense framework.
- Russia maintains that the ABM Treaty is still valid and that any changes would undermine strategic stability and the balance of power.
Key Information
- The ABM Treaty, signed in 1972, restricts the deployment of national missile defense systems to prevent the erosion of strategic stability.
- The treaty limits each party to a single ABM deployment area, with no more than 100 interceptors and 100 launchers.
- The U.S. has faced significant technical and political challenges in developing a viable NMD system.
- The U.S. is pursuing a multi-layered missile defense strategy, which includes both TMD and NMD systems.
- The debate over the ABM Treaty is central to the broader arms control agenda, with implications for nuclear stability and global security.
